- The distance between Millport, Oh, Usa and Kuujjuaq, Qc, Canada is approximately 2,099 km or 1,304 mi.
- To reach Millport, Oh in this distance one would set out from Kuujjuaq, Qc bearing 210.5° or SS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Millport, Oh bearing 200.8° or SSW .
- Millport, Oh has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Kuujjuaq, Qc has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Millport, Oh is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Kuujjuaq, Qc is in or near the subpolar wet tundra bi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 15.1 °C (27.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.1 °C (16.4°F) less in Millport, Oh.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 441.2 mm (17.4 in) more which is equivalent to 441.2 l/m² (10.83 US gal/ft²) or 4,412,000 l/ha (471,672 US gal/ac) more. About 1 5/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 17.1° higher in Millport, Oh than in Kuujjuaq, Qc.
